P\\'erez","submitted_at":"2013-04-27T22:58:02Z","abstract_excerpt":"We obtain limits on the quartic neutral gauge bosons couplings $Z\\gamma\\gamma\\gamma$ and $ZZ\\gamma\\gamma$ using LEP 2 data published by the L3 Collaboration on the reactions $e^+e^-\\to \\gamma\\gamma\\gamma, Z\\gamma\\gamma$. We also obtain $95 \\%$ C. L. limits on these couplings at the future linear colliders energies. The LEP 2 data induce limits of order $10^{-5}$ $GeV^{-4}$ for the $Z\\gamma\\gamma\\gamma$ couplings and of order $10^{-3}$ $GeV^{-2}$ for the $ZZ\\gamma\\gamma$ couplings, which are still above the respective Standard Model predictions.
